Tumor‐related epilepsy in glioma: A multidisciplinary overview
Abstract Seizures are a common and challenging symptom in brain tumors, affecting approximately 60% of patients. Tumor‐related epilepsy (TRE) in glioma patients requires personalized and dynamic management in a multidisciplinary environment, especially for its intricate pathophysiology and unpredictable disease evolution.
